Warning Signs You Need Living Room Water Removal

Beware of these warning signs that show you need living room water removal services. Ignoring these signs can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, lingering musty odors in your living room can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ore the smell; it can lead to mold growth and further damage.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ring can show water damage. Don’t delay repairs; it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can show water damage. Don’t delay repairs; it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age. Don’t delay repairs; it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Unpleasant Odors from Your Air Vents

Unpleasant odors from your air vents can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ore the smell; it can lead to mold growth and further damage.

Unusual Sounds from Your Ceiling or Walls

Unusual sounds from your ceiling or walls can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ore the sound; it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Living Room Water Removal Cost in Palm Springs, FL

The cost of living room water removal in Palm Springs, FL,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age to ensure you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Water Damage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ed

The ex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ment by our team. We offer free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Living Room Water Removal

How Long Does Living Room Water Removal Take?

Our team will work to dry out your living room as quickly as possible. The time it takes to complete the job dep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the job.

Is Living Room Water Removal Covered by Insurance?

Yes, living room water removal may be covered by your insurance. Check your policy to see what’s covered and what’s not. Our team will work with you to document the damage and ensure you’re reimbursed for the costs.

What Happens if I Ignore Water Damage?

Ignoring water damage can lead to mold growth and further damage to your living room. It can also lead to health risks from mold exposure. Don’t delay repairs; call a professional to ensure your living room is safe and healthy.
